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
using Microsoft.Extensions.Logging;
using Vectra.Application.Abstractions.Dispatchers;
using Vectra.Application.Abstractions.Dispatchers;
using Vectra.Application.Abstractions.Persistence;
using Vectra.Application.Abstractions.Security;
using Vectra.BuildingBlocks.Results;
Expand All @@ -9,16 +8,13 @@ namespace Vectra.Application.Features.Agents.RegisterAgent;

internal class CreateAgentHandler : IActionHandler<CreateAgentRequest, Result<CreateAgentResult>>
{
private readonly ILogger<CreateAgentHandler> _logger;
private readonly IAgentRepository _agentRepository;
private readonly ISecretHasher _secretHasher;

public CreateAgentHandler(
ILogger<CreateAgentHandler> logger,
IAgentRepository agentRepository,
ISecretHasher secretHasher)
{
_logger = logger ?? throw new ArgumentNullException(nameof(logger));
_agentRepository = agentRepository ?? throw new ArgumentNullException(nameof(agentRepository));
_secretHasher = secretHasher ?? throw new ArgumentNullException(nameof(secretHasher));
}
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
using Microsoft.Extensions.Logging;
using Vectra.Application.Abstractions.Dispatchers;
using Vectra.Application.Abstractions.Dispatchers;
using Vectra.Application.Abstractions.Executions;
using Vectra.Application.Abstractions.Persistence;
using Vectra.Application.Abstractions.Security;
Expand All @@ -12,18 +11,15 @@ namespace Vectra.Application.Features.Authentications.GenerateToken;

internal class GenerateTokenHandler : IActionHandler<GenerateTokenRequest, Result<GenerateTokenResult>>
{
private readonly ILogger<GenerateTokenHandler> _logger;
private readonly IAgentRepository _agentRepository;
private readonly ITokenService _tokenService;
private readonly ISecretHasher _secretHasher;

public GenerateTokenHandler(
ILogger<GenerateTokenHandler> logger,
IAgentRepository agentRepository,
ITokenService tokenService,
ISecretHasher secretHasher)
{
_logger = logger ?? throw new ArgumentNullException(nameof(logger));
_agentRepository = agentRepository ?? throw new ArgumentNullException(nameof(agentRepository));
_tokenService = tokenService ?? throw new ArgumentNullException(nameof(tokenService));
_secretHasher = secretHasher ?? throw new ArgumentNullException(nameof(secretHasher));
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,3 @@
using Microsoft.Extensions.Logging;
using Vectra.Application.Abstractions.Dispatchers;
using Vectra.Application.Abstractions.Executions;
using Vectra.BuildingBlocks.Results;
Expand All @@ -7,12 +6,10 @@ namespace Vectra.Application.Features.Hitl.GetAllPending;

internal class GetAllPendingHandler : IActionHandler<GetAllPendingRequest, PaginatedResult<PendingHitlRequest>>
{
private readonly ILogger<GetAllPendingHandler> _logger;
private readonly IHitlService _hitlService;

public GetAllPendingHandler(ILogger<GetAllPendingHandler> logger, IHitlService hitlService)
public GetAllPendingHandler(IHitlService hitlService)
{
_logger = logger ?? throw new ArgumentNullException(nameof(logger));
_hitlService = hitlService ?? throw new ArgumentNullException(nameof(hitlService));
}

Expand Down
Loading